Two in one Wind and Solar Charger for mobile devices by Kinesis

Kinesis has developed very good product for charging mobile devices that can charge many portable devices like ipod, mobile, camera, etc, it uses both wind and solar energy. leaving the device all day in wind can charge 20 hours of internal battery and in direct sunlight could charge upto 8 hours. Internal battery power could be transferred to music player, phone,etc via USB port.

Eco-friendly batteries "EnviroMAX" by Fuji

Recent batteries are very harmful for our planet as is contains cadmium or mercury or other harmful ingredients for our environment, so Fuji has developed the new solution by using recyclable materials and not using harmful materials in its new EnviroMAX batteries, this batteries are packed with recyclable paper and PET plastic which can be disposed at any landfills for degrading or normal wast system.

According to Fuji it has equal performance to the recent major brands and with affordable price, US$3.99 per pack for "Super Alkaline" which is available in AA and AAA for toys,flashlights,etc and US$5.99 per pack for "Digital Alkaline" available in AA and AAA for high drain electronic devices like digital cameras, video games, etc.

This batteries are going to be manufactured by Fuji Batteries at Japan, so in future we could see some Eco friendly green batteries in our latest gadgets and toys.

Power generating shoes

Japans telecom company NTT Docomo has developed prototype shoes that's generates electricity while we walk around, it has water filled soles which is attached with small generator which produce enough electricity for portable music player, according to the company shoe is generating 1.2 watts of energy, they are trying to increase its power generating capacity at 3 watts which enough to power the cell phone, if this futuristic shoes comes in market it will change the way of charging our portable device in future, but we have to some time as company is planing to launch this shoe in 2010.[physorg]

Next Generation Underwater Turbine

Under water tidal power generation is not a new technology but it is improving day by day recently a group of engineers of oxford developed new design called Transverse Horizontal Axis Water Turbine which they think is more powerful and efficient than resent technology, according to them THAWT's ( Transverse Horizontal Axis Water Turbine ) manufacturing cost is 60% lower and has 40% lower maintenance cost.THAWT uses different technique than recent technology which has works as wind mill underwater, THAWT uses cylindrical rotors that rolls around its long axis with the flow of water. According to the engineer THAWT could produce 12 megawatts of energy which is enough for 12000 homes that recent one.

But even though with their achievement they are concerned of underwater ecology,Steph Merry, head of Renewable energy has told that in there design they have taken full consideration of climate change and the requirement of safeguarding the ecology of tidal areas.[Guardian.co.uk]

Ball Wind Turbine Power for Home

















What a good looking wind turbine it does not look like traditional wind turbine, it is specially design for home user who want green and clean energy. Swedish engineered has designed this turbine. Swedish company named Home Energy has developed this innovative wind  turbine it works on Venturi principal, which funnels wind within the turbines blade. Home Energy has named it Energy Ball, spherical wind turbine design has increased its efficiency with less noise which is very good for home  users.

Energy Ball which works on Venturi Principal uses 6 blades to channel air through for spinning turbine, its special can take advantage of very low wind speed. The company Home Energy has specialty for developing small scale energy solution for home and offices and this Energy Ball is a great that they have developed any body could take and advantage of  it for green and clean energy.[FooZooDesign]

Cheaper backsheet for solar panels by BioSolar

Solar panels are getting costly as photovoltaic modules in solar panels are made of petroleum-based plastics as a protective backing and you know that petrol price are getting higher but this all is going to change as company named BioSolar has developed bio-based back sheet for solar panels according to them it could last for 20-25 years and manufacturing cost is also 25% cheaper than plastic.


The standard solar panel backsheet costs between $0.70 and $1.00 per square foot. BioSolar’s material is currently estimated to reduce manufacturing costs by 25%, and the company believes it possible to reach the 50% mark. The biomaterial can be produced using existing industrial machines, eliminating the need to purchase new manufacturing systems and lowering costs for adopters.BioSolar expects the market for solar panel backsheets to grow from its current value of $300 million to $1 billion by 2010. Future of Green Energy is below Ground

Future of our energy needs could be satisfied by the hot magma in our earth Australian study says that 1% of Australia's geothermal power potential could provide the nation with a whopping 26,000 years of energy.

It could relay works it could solve our big need of energy. Australian Geothermal Energy Association says that this could work my drilling 2.8 miles into the surface of the earth into the hot magma. This project could cost $10.45 billion but this is only one them cost after this is done we could get green energy for atleast 26,000 years.[DVICE]

Flying Power Plant by "Cool Earth"

Cool Earth has developed new solar power technology which could be the lightest solar concentrator it weight just 20 pound. This power plant is inflatable with transparent plastic on the top and reflective plastic on the bottom which concentrate sunlight on PV cell placed at the focal point.


The company is trying to reduce its cost and clamming that one balloon can generate 500 watts which enough for chilling our bear. let us see when this technology is comes in the market in future we cold see our house or office electricity is produce by this type of balloon flying in garden on terace. Ventomobile Car Which Runs on Wind Energy

We have heard about future cars driving on electricity,hydrogen,bio fuels and gas but now there is new concept "wind powered cars" yes now cars are going to run on wind energy. Stuttgart University student's has developed this vehicle called Ventomobile. They also tested this vehicle in wind tunnel and the results are also very good.

The vehicle has three wheels and two rotor blade on top. They are going to take part in three kilometer track race at Nether land where five team of different university are going compete. This race is unique where all vehicle has to run on wind power this race is called RACING AEOLUS.

So we could see this eco friendly green wind energy vehicle cars in near future on our roads.[Science Daily]

Cheaper Fuel Cells For Cars


Australian researchers has developed a cathode built fuel cells which are cheaper than traditional fuel cells.

Researchers of Australian Center of Excellence for Electromaterials Science has developed this cell with help of materials engineer professor Maria Forsythe.

Traditional fuel cells which convert hydrogen and oxygen to electricity which runs the car are made of cathode which has expensive platinum nanoparticles which can lose effectiveness by clumping togeather or becoming poisoned by carbon monoxide and they cost $3500 to $4000 for a single passenger car it covers almost cost of fuel cell.

New cathode which are developed from conducting polymer is a special plastic that can conduct electricity called poly or PEDOT.

This cathode materials easy to made are even cheaper almost several hundred dollars it is also stable than platinum which is affected by carbon monoxide.

This cathode material can also be used in zinc air batteries but it is a testing procedure which could be used in storing electricity in cars.[abc.net]
